Elements Influencing Dry Eye Advancement



Dry eye disorder can be influenced by various variables that add to its growth. One significant factor is age. As you age, your eyes might generate fewer tears or rips of minimal quality, causing dryness.

Specific medical conditions like diabetes mellitus, thyroid problems, and autoimmune conditions can likewise affect tear manufacturing and quality, intensifying dry eye signs. Hormonal changes, specifically in ladies throughout menopause, can contribute to dry eyes also.

Furthermore, medicines such as antihistamines, decongestants, and antidepressants can reduce tear production and create dry skin. Environmental elements like smoke, wind, and dry air can aggravate the eyes and aggravate dry eye signs and symptoms.

Furthermore, extended display time and digital gadget use can bring about decreased blinking, leading to inadequate tear circulation throughout the eyes. Understanding these aspects can assist you identify possible triggers for your dry eye symptoms and take proactive actions to manage and reduce them.

Environmental Triggers and Dry Eye



Exposure to various ecological elements can dramatically impact the advancement and exacerbation of completely dry eye signs. Contaminants like dirt, smoke, and air contamination can irritate the eyes, bring about raised tear evaporation and dry skin.

Environment problems such as low moisture levels, high temperatures, and windy weather can also contribute to moisture loss from the eyes, triggering discomfort and completely dry eye symptoms. In addition, spending expanded durations in air-conditioned or warmed settings can reduce air dampness, more intensifying completely dry eye.

Long term use of electronic screens, common in today's technology-driven globe, can also strain the eyes and reduce blink rates, resulting in not enough tear manufacturing and dry eye problems. To decrease the effect of ecological triggers on completely dry eye, consider using a humidifier, taking breaks from display time, wearing protective eyeglasses in gusty conditions, and making use of synthetic tears or lubricating eye drops as required.

Being mindful of these environmental variables can assist manage and stop dry eye signs and symptoms effectively.

Lifestyle Habits Impacting Eye Wetness



How do your day-to-day routines affect the moisture levels in your eyes? Your way of life plays a considerable role in determining the health of your eyes.

For instance, not consuming enough water can cause dehydration, triggering your eyes to come to be dry and inflamed.

Additionally, investing extended durations staring at displays can minimize your blink price, resulting in boosted tear evaporation and dry skin.

Smoking cigarettes is one more way of life routine that can intensify completely dry eye symptoms, as it can aggravate the eyes and contribute to tear film instability.

In addition, eating too much amounts of high levels of caffeine or alcohol can dehydrate your body, including your eyes, making them a lot more vulnerable to dry skin.



Absence of sleep can likewise influence eye dampness levels, as sufficient rest is necessary for tear manufacturing and total eye health.
